Managing your assets
After you deploy SupportAssist, the system details are automatically collected and displayed in the Manage Assets page in
TechDirect. Use the Manage Assets page to organize your assets into groups and to integrate your SupportAssist alerts with
ServiceNow.
NOTE: You require Device Management Administrator rights to manage your assets in TechDirect.

Manage Assets
The Manage Assets page enables you to perform various actions on the assets that are managed using SupportAssist.
However, the actions that you can perform depend on the account type that is used to log in to TechDirect, for example, Device
Management Administrator or Device Management Technician.
To manage your assets, go to Services > Device Management > Manage Assets.
Use the following links that are displayed on the Manage Assets page to perform various actions:
My Assetsview details about your assets such as service plans, expiration date, and so on. You can also click the Service
Tag of each PC to perform remote optimizations on that system. See My Assets on page 21 and Managing single PC on
page 27.
Organize Assets and Groupscreate or delete a group and move assets across groups. See Organizing assets and groups
on page 24.
Integrate with ServiceNowenable or disable integration of SupportAssist alerts with your ServiceNow solution. See
Integrating SupportAssist alerts with ServiceNow on page 33.
My Assets
The My Assets page displays a graphical representation of the number of PCs with:
Current service plans
SupportAssist versions
The My Assets page also displays information about your managed assets. By default, the Site, Group, Service Tag, Region,
Product Type, Model, and Warranty Plan columns are displayed. Click
in the bottom-left corner of the table to select the
columns you want to view.
To view the My Assets page, go to Services > Device Management > Manage Assets.
The following table describes the information that is displayed on the My Assets page:
Table 9. My Assets
Column Description
Site Name of the site to which the asset is assigned.
Group Group to which the asset is assigned.
Service Tag The unique identifier of the system. The Service Tag is an
alpha-numeric sequence.
